Obituary of Patricia Dawn Moffet

 

1940-2020

Scotts Valley, California

Our dear mother, Patricia Dawn Moffet, passed away at her home Wednesday December 16th, 2020 of complications due to Colon Cancer.  Mom was a fighter to the very end, showing strength, courage, dignity and optimism throughout her illness.  No matter what the setback, she pressed forward. 

She is survived by her children Alan (Tricia), Brian (Naomi), and Suzanne (Erik); her grandchildren Kyle, Ryan (Madison), Kalyn (Eric), Erika and Zach, and one great grandchild, Adalyn.  She is also survived by her brothers Peter (Linda) and William (Ruth), sister-in-law Joan, and a number of nieces and nephews.

Pat was born in New Jersey in 1940 but spent her youth in Pennsylvania.  In 1958, while working in Washington D.C., she met Michael and they were married the next year.  Following a few years in Japan, they settled their family in California.  For a decade, Mike was often away because of his service in the Navy, and mom supported him and our country by raising us.  She and dad put their children’s needs first.  When Mike was finally able to work at Treasure Island as an instructor or developing curriculum, they settled into a more normal life.  Smart and independent, mom occasionally got behind the wheel of a sports car for a race or learned to ride a motorcycle so she could ride with dad. 

Mom worked as a Secretary and office manager for Monarch International and completed her associate degree in Supervision and Management at SJCC.

Together, while living in Foresthill, California, they volunteered hundreds of hours for Placer County. Much of their time was spent at the Foresthill Divide Museum or the annual Garage Sale for the Volunteer Firefighter Association.  Pat also served in the Sheriff’s Department.

Mom loved animals.  She especially loved her two cats, Amy and Brin - who she adopted from Project Purr.  She also loved flowers and other beautiful plants. When we visited botanical gardens, she talked about the many varieties and took notes on some she did not know much about.  She enjoyed caring for the plants she had at home.  She was an avid reader.  She enjoyed collecting antique glass or making things from stained glass.

We will miss her.
